WELCOME TO HALIFAX !

Halifax is the largest town of Calderdale, West Yorkshire, frequented by international and national tourists interested in landmarks from Victorian and Georgian times. Eureka Childrens Museum:

Eureka Children Museum fosters learning among kids via cool activities. It is an interactive museum dedicated for children between 0 to 11 years of age (also interesting for kids between 11 and 60 J ) and has separate sections to facilitate learning activities. The museum promotes interactive learning and contains various attractions for children of all ages. The Cafeteria enables sustenance so adults can keep up with the children and the children wont miss their nutritional requirements.

Exhibitions take place regularly to help children explore and discover their talents. Six galleries in total are present where scientific models are present and activities related to music and theatre take place. Interactive shows and science experiments are also held all around the year for families at different timings.

Manor Health Park and The Jungle Experience:

Manor Health Park and Jungle Experience is an outdoor play area catering for kids of all ages. It contains various learning opportunities for children and is spread over 19 acres. Scenic flowers, woodland, walks, picnic spots, water play area, outdoor sports and gym will provide enough variety to wear even the most energetic 10 years olds batteries flat.

The health park is divided into four major sections with each of these having particular plants and environment. Tropical Oasis, Savage Garden, Butterfly World and Lily Pond are the prominent sections. Savage Garden contains insect eating plants while Tropical Oasis is reserved for terrapins, butterflies, aquatic species and botanical gardens.

Shibden Hall:

Shibden Hall is a must. It has both indoor and outdoor attractions on 90 acres of area. Walks, woodland, orienteering course, playground, pitch and putt, miniature railway and boating lake are major points of attraction. The picnic point is suitable for children between 0 to 12 years old. Inside the Hall, the lives of previous inhabitants is documented with artefacts.

Electric Bowl:

Electric Bowl might be a saviour on a rainy day. It is an indoor games specialist. Families can enjoy picnics by playing snooker and tenpin bowling. There are many restaurants and dining areas present where lunch, dinner and snacks can be enjoyed after getting tired from the activities. It is suitable for children between 9 to 18 years of age. Big Blue Frog:

Big Blue Frog is an indoor play place that is considered as one of the biggest and best in Calderdale. It is suitable for kids up to 12 years old and is categorised into separate floors for different age groups. Smart ball canon area, slides, building blocks, ball ropes, bridges and tunnels will keep the kids engaged for hours. A soft play area is maintained for the little ones to avoid injuries. Birthday parties can also be held for children with desired themes and the adorable big blue mascot.

Sportsman Inn and Leisure:

For extreme winter sports, this is the place to be. The sportsman inn is the place for snow tubing, skiing and snowboarding, its made possible due snow-like material called Snowflex. The facility offers support in advanced techniques such as bump skiing, big air jumps, fun box and 1/4 pipe.

An indoor play area called Charlie Fastrax is also available with loads of tunnels, coloured ball pools, slides, climbing frames and spooky caves. This soft play area is safe for young toddlers and the little, little kids.

Play Palace:

Play Palace is an indoor play area with facilities that make it a secure place for children up to 11 years old. It is a royal place with cool play area with slides and ball pits. Many other game areas are also available where children can enjoy full day and have snacks at the restaurants.

The Mill Play Centre:

Mill Play Centre is recommended for toddlers and young children due to soft play area facilities. Classic gaming areas will keep the older children busy for hours
